🚨 2014 Toyota Camry: Emergency Neutral
The 2014 Camry Hybrid (XV50 generation) uses a console-mounted electronic shift lever with a shift-lock override release.

⚠️ Chock the wheels first — neutral means the car can roll. Set the parking brake while you work, never stand downhill of the vehicle, and try a 12-volt jump before any override: power fixes most stuck-in-park problems instantly.
The procedure
- Ensure the parking brake is firmly set and the vehicle is on level ground or properly supported.
- Turn the ignition to ON or press the power button (without brake pedal if dead brake-light switch) if 12V power is available.
- Locate the shift-lock override: Look for a small rectangular cap or slot on the console near the base of the shifter, typically on the left side or front-left corner of the shifter surround.
- Use a flathead screwdriver or ignition key to carefully pry off or open the override cover.
- Press the brake pedal (if you have 12V power and a working brake-light switch) and simultaneously insert the tool into the override slot and press down or pull the mechanical tab.
- While holding the override actuated and pressing the brake, move the shifter from P to N.
- If the 12V battery is completely dead, see 'No Power Notes' below.
Shift-lock override location
Small rectangular cap or slot on the console near the base of the shifter, typically on the left side or front-left corner of the shifter surround; exact position may vary slightly with trim.
With zero electrical power
With zero 12V power, the hybrid system will not initialize and the shift-lock solenoid will not release even with the override tool. You must provide power to the 12V auxiliary battery (located under the hood on the driver's side) via jump-start or battery charger. A brief connection is usually enough to allow the shift-lock override to function and move the shifter to N. If jump power is unavailable, the vehicle must be loaded onto a flatbed without shifting.
⚡ EV / hybrid warning
CRITICAL: The 2014 Camry Hybrid has NO tow-mode or mechanical neutral bypass. The hybrid transaxle keeps the motor/generators electrically coupled to the wheels even when 'off.' Towing with drive wheels on the ground when the hybrid system is not fully powered can generate dangerous high voltage and cause catastrophic damage to the inverter, motor/generators, and transaxle. FLATBED TOW ONLY unless the vehicle powers on completely and you can verify N on the instrument cluster. Even in N, if the hybrid system is non-functional, do NOT tow with wheels down.
